Building Trust with Patients

Trust between the patient and counselor is foundational in psychiatric counseling. This rapport not only makes patients feel safe in sharing their thoughts and feelings but also enhances their willingness to adhere to prescribed treatments. Techniques such as active listening, empathy, consistent follow-ups, conferring unconditional positive regard, and maintaining confidentiality are all vital in establishing trust. Further developing trust requires counselors to be patient, open-minded, and non-judgmental. These qualities encourage an environment where patients feel truly supported and valued during their treatment journey.

Tailoring Approaches to Individual Needs

Every individual’s mental health needs are unique, making personalized treatment plans crucial for effective psychiatric counseling. By assessing each patient’s specific circumstances, challenges, and strengths, counselors can develop customized strategies that best address these individual requirements. Adaptability should extend beyond therapeutic modalities — it should also consider cultural sensitivities, personal preferences, and even the client’s lifestyle.

This personalized approach ensures that each counseling session remains relevant and beneficial for the patient, thereby improving overall care outcomes significantly.

Incorporating Evidence-Based Practices

To provide high-quality psychiatric counseling, it is crucial to base treatment methods on evidence-based practices. These practices are developed through rigorous research and have been proven effective repeatedly across various patient demographics and conditions. Techniques such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), and mindfulness-based interventions are some examples that have extensive evidence supporting their efficacy.

Staying updated with current research findings and incorporating them into practice not only enhances therapeutic outcomes but also reinforces counselor credibility among peers and patients alike.

Continuous Professional Development

Ongoing education is crucial for counselors who wish to maintain the efficacy of their practice. Regular training sessions, workshops, seminars about new therapies, and advanced courses help professionals update themselves on recent advancements in psychiatric theories and interventions. Inevitably, this ongoing professional development translates into better quality care provided to patients.

Focusing on Holistic Health

In psychiatric counseling, addressing only the psychological aspects may not be sufficient to foster full recovery for some patients. A holistic approach considering physical health factors such as diet, exercise regime, sleep patterns along with mental health can provide more comprehensive support to patients. Often aligning physical health goals alongside mental health targets helps mitigate symptoms more effectively and promotes sustained wellness.

A holistic focus ensures that all components affecting a patient’s life are accounted for within their recovery plan, leading to more durable and encompassing improvement in their overall health.
